We’ve met possibly the youngest councillor in Essex, now here’s a contender for the most experienced.

Last week, the Standard reported how Will Radley, 18, had joined Althorne Parish Council.

Tilly Pink, who was 87 on Monday, could be the oldest.

Mrs Pink, whose real name is Rosina, has been on Wickham Bishops Parish Council since at least 1972, although she admits she cannot remember exactly when she was elected.

She came up with the idea for a new village hall, is president of Maldon Golf Club, and still attends the luncheon club she set up in the 1970s.

Mrs Pink was awarded a CBE in 1996 for her voluntary work, including her post as county organiser for the Women’s Royal Voluntary Service, and represents Maldon on the Essex Association of Local Councils.
